software pressman objetivo modelo management linea ingenieria gestion ejemplo datos configuración configuracion auditoria configuration-management

configuration-management - pressman - modelo de configuracion ingenieria de software



Definición oficial de CSCI(elemento de configuración de software de computadora) (1)

Estoy buscando la definición más oficial de CSCI / Elemento de configuración, no solo lo que es, sino lo que tenemos que entregar / esperar cuando un contrato define subsistemas que se desarrollarán como elementos de configuración.

Pasé un poco de tiempo con mi famosa herramienta de búsqueda y encontré muchas explicaciones para CSCI (wikipedia, directorios de acrónimos, ...) pero no he encontrado un estándar o un puntero a un estándar (como ISO-xxx) todavía que indica (1) qué es y (2) qué se debe hacer desde el punto de vista de QM / CM.

Solo pregunto, porque un representante de QM de los contratistas declaró durante una prueba de aceptación, que el IC solo requiere no olvidar el IC en el plan de configuración y asignar un número de serie ... esperaba ver algunos SRS, SDD, ICD, SVD, SIP, ... documentos y documentación de prueba de aceptación para esos subsistemas ...


Por lo que puedo decir, CSCI se definió en la misma lógica que HWCI (elemento de configuración de hardware) en DOD-STD-2167A, que simplemente definió CSCI como un elemento de configuración.

La definición más clara está en MIL-STD-498 que sustituyó al DOD-STD-2167A:

CSCI: una agregación de software que satisface una función de uso final y está designada para la administración de la configuración por parte del adquirente. Los CSCI se seleccionan en función de las compensaciones entre la función de software, el tamaño, las computadoras host o de destino, el desarrollador, el concepto de soporte, los planes para la reutilización, la criticidad, las consideraciones de interfaz, deben documentarse y controlarse por separado, y otros factores.

Creo que tendría sentido cuando asigna CSCI a una aplicación de entrega. Un CSCI requerirá básicamente un conjunto de SRS y SDD. Un sistema puede comprender uno o más CSCI, por lo que pueden existir otros documentos entregables como ICD y documentos de prueba para el sistema.